Question about the editor, how can I set the direction of a SAM unit radar? For example when I add a SAM Bty (Sky Bow I/II Bty [Tien Kung 1/2, Mobile] its course is by default 0 deg and the radar system is fixed to something like 80 degree direction. I have found no way to change the direction.

It is the same thing with Patriot PAC-2 batteries. Course is 0 and radar is pointing to 80 degrees or so. Also when you add a patriot unit it does not have any radar at all, just the Mk1 Eyeball. So if you manually add a sensor (the AN/MPQ-53 in this case) then you can choose which direction it should point to. Surely this cannot be the way how it is supposed to be handled?

You set the direction by right clicking on the unit and selecting "Set Orientation" at the very bottom. You then use the slider to adjust the heading.

Reference the Patriot PAC-2, it appears you are correct - in the database entry it shows the AN/MPQ-53 radar in the mounts section but when you go to the sensors window (F9), the only thing there is Mk1 Eyeball.

This is definitely a change with the Build 469 database and I know for sure the MPQ-53 was available in the F9 screen with the Build 460 DB. Not sure if the change was by design or not.
